Research and rank festivals with strategy

Choosing the right festivals is key for a film’s success. Begin by analyzing programming focus, genre fit, audience profile, timing, and premiere rules. Major festivals like Cannes, Sundance, Toronto, Venice, and Berlin often seek world or international premieres. Reserve these opportunities for films aiming for maximum industry impact.

Match programming and premiere rules

Examine each festival’s curator priorities and national roles. Look at past lineups to understand what programmers favor. Note premiere requirements and whether a festival prioritizes national films, political content, or experimental work. This research enhances movie festival distribution outcomes and guides film festival media distribution choices.

Build a festival runway and prioritized list

Develop a spreadsheet with at least 80 region and genre-specific festivals. Track dates, submission deadlines, premiere rules, programmer names, and LinkedIn profiles. Rank festivals by programming fit, geographic reach, industry presence, and visibility. Submit to your top choice first and wait for a decision before moving to the next. Plan a two-year calendar: major festivals in year one and targeted platforms in year two.

Festival Tier Programming Fit Premiere Rule Visibility Outcome
Tier A (Cannes, Sundance, TIFF – Toronto) High—global industry focus World or international premiere often required Strong buyer interest and press coverage
Tier B (SXSW, Telluride, Berlinale sections) Moderate—genre-friendly and innovation focused Regional premiere sometimes preferred Good press and niche buyer attention
Tier C (regional festivals, genre events) Audience-specific or genre-specific focus Flexible with premiere status Community engagement and long-term reach

Budget submission fees and request waivers

Submission fees can add up quickly. Create a budget that covers fees, travel, per diems, wardrobe, and PR. Reach out to programmers when funds are tight and request fee waivers. Many programmers support serious applicants and will waive fees to help promising projects reach their stage.

Collect programmer contacts and follow their professional updates. Send timely production updates without spamming. Track deadlines and submission status closely to avoid missing strategic openings. This practical discipline supports a film marketing strategy that uses media distribution services and film festival networking to maximize exposure.

Understanding no electricity water heaters and how they work

Multiple methods make it possible to have hot water without using the electrical grid. Certain systems use direct combustion; others lean on solar thermal collection or passive-flow circulation. Each method aims to provide consistent hot water without the need for electric controls or pumps.

Core operating principles

Combustion-style units use propane, natural gas, or wood as fuel to heat water. They can provide heat on demand or keep heated water in an insulated storage tank. Tankless propane water heaters, on the other hand, heat water as it flows through a compact heat exchanger. That setup means fuel is only consumed when you open a tap.

Tank systems maintain a reserve of hot water, while tankless designs rely on instant heat transfer. This strategy helps make sure hot water is ready whenever it’s needed.

Physical and chemical cleaning principles in non-electric designs

Some non-electric hot water heaters use gravity-driven circulation to reduce sediment buildup. They include internal baffles and flow pathways that steer particles toward drain points during operation. This helps in maintaining water quality and reducing the need for manual maintenance.

These systems also employ chemical coatings or media inside the tank. Such coatings hinder bacterial growth and scale deposits without powered filtration. As a result, there are fewer odors and less fouling on heat exchange surfaces, supporting consistent hot-water delivery.

Common fuels and heat exchange techniques

Typical fuels include propane, natural gas, firewood, and captured solar thermal energy. Tankless propane water heaters utilize compact counterflow or condensing heat exchangers. These are made from materials like copper or stainless steel.

Indirect-fired systems instead place a coil or jacket around the storage tank. The coil or jacket moves heat from a separate burner or boiler into the stored water. Solar-based options gather heat with evacuated tube collectors or flat-plate solar panels.

Thermosiphon systems and gravity-fed arrangements move hot water with no mechanical pumps. They rely on natural convection. Wood-fired units often employ direct-fire coils. These coils pass water through or around the combustion chamber for efficient heat transfer.

Off-grid water heating solutions that support sustainable living

Living off the grid requires a reliable water heater for comfort and independence. Off-grid solutions combine basic physics with dependable fuels. They help ensure hot water in remote locations such as cabins, tiny homes, and rural properties. In this section, you’ll find practical choices and sizing tips tailored to real-world use.

Working with off-grid solar power and battery-free configurations

Solar thermal collectors directly heat water, eliminating the need for batteries. Passive systems, like thermosiphon loops, use gravity and temperature differences for fluid circulation. These systems are durable when installed correctly, with the right tilt and insulation.

Solar thermal often works best when combined with a tankless propane or gravity-fed heater for backup. With this hybrid approach, solar covers sunny periods while non-electric backup handles cloudy days. Brands like Rheem and Bosch offer tankless propane models ideal for off-grid living.

Sizing and capacity considerations for off-grid households

First, estimate the peak flow by looking at each fixture and its GPM. Efficient showerheads typically use about 1.5–2.5 GPM. Multiply your peak demand by expected usage hours to estimate tank size for solar collectors.

Account for collector area, tank capacity, and your available fuel sources. For a small two-person cabin, a 30–40 gallon tank paired with 20–40 square feet of collector area is often enough. Bigger households typically demand greater collector area and/or a bigger tank. When choosing a tankless unit, ensure it can handle your water temperature and flow.

Example use cases for cabins, tiny homes, and rural properties

Small cabins frequently rely on compact tankless propane units or single-panel thermosiphon solar setups. Tiny homes tend to favor tankless options to save space and avoid heavy storage tanks. Combination setups that pair solar with propane provide both efficiency and reliability.

Some rural properties select wood-fired or indirect-fired boilers, especially where wood heating is already common. They can integrate with existing plumbing to provide abundant hot water for washing and bathing. Pick proven components and follow a regular maintenance schedule to keep off-grid systems reliable.

Types of non-electric hot water heaters and how they compare

If you need hot water without depending on the grid, you can choose from several practical options. This overview explains the trade-offs among compact on-demand units, simple passive systems, and fuel-based tank solutions. You should match your chosen system to the site, local fuel supply, and the level of maintenance you’re willing to handle.

Tankless propane and natural gas choices

Tankless propane water heaters deliver hot water only when you call for it. They come in various sizes, from small units that offer 2–6 GPM to larger models that can deliver 8–10+ GPM for whole-house use. Their compact form allows them to fit into tight areas, including mechanical closets and tiny homes. For U.S. installations, it’s crucial to provide correct venting and combustion air to prevent backdraft and keep combustion safe.

Thermosiphon and gravity-fed water heater systems

A gravity-fed thermosiphon system depends on basic physics to move water. Warm water rises, and cooler water sinks, creating a passive flow when the tank is above the heat source. Thermosiphon solar systems move heated fluid without pumps, which makes them ideal for low-maintenance setups. These systems work best when there’s a natural elevation difference and you prefer a pump-free, quiet option.

Indirect-fired and wood-driven water heaters

Indirect-fired systems use a boiler or stove to heat a coil inside a separate storage tank. By separating combustion from potable water, this setup reduces corrosion and scale issues. Wood-fired options include batch boilers and continuous-feed back boilers that heat water directly. Batch systems require scheduled loading and more hands-on tending. Continuous-feed units can run for longer periods but need consistent fuel quality and routine ash removal.

System type Typical flow/output Best application Maintenance needs
Tankless propane units Around 2–10+ GPM Tiny homes, cabins, and primary homes with proper venting Yearly burner and vent inspection
Gravity-fed thermosiphon systems Low to moderate; depends on site layout Off-grid solar setups and simple cottages Minimal; inspect fittings and freeze protection periodically
Indirect-fired (coil-based) systems Varies by boiler size Homes with existing boiler or wood stove Regular boiler/coil inspections and basic water quality management
Direct wood-fired systems Batch: intermittent output; continuous: steadier output Remote cabins, properties with wood supply Chimney cleaning, ash removal, and careful fuel feed control

Pick a system according to your everyday hot water needs, the space you have, and accessible fuel sources. For low-maintenance operation, a gravity-fed thermosiphon or smaller tankless propane unit can be a good match. For independence from fossil fuels and a strong performance, opt for a wood-fired or indirect-fired system, but be prepared for more hands-on care.

Performance and installation of tankless propane water heaters

Tankless propane systems provide on-demand hot water through flow-activated burners and adjustable gas valves. Opening a tap activates a sensor that tells the burner to fire. The heat exchanger transfers energy directly to the water, ensuring continuous hot water without storage losses. The temperature of incoming water determines your achievable flow rate and final outlet temperature.

How tankless units deliver on-demand hot water

Flow sensors pick up minor draws and tune the modulating gas valve so heat output tracks the water flow. This maintains a stable output temperature over changing demand levels. Typically, stainless steel or copper heat exchangers resist corrosion while speeding heat transfer. The result is efficient delivery of hot water for showers, dishwashers, and laundry, without the standby losses tied to tanks.

Ventilation, safety and code considerations in the United States

Safe operation depends heavily on proper venting. Based on the specific model and location, your installation may call for direct-vent, power-vent, or atmospheric venting. You must also provide enough combustion air and follow carbon monoxide safety guidelines, including alarms in living areas. Local plumbing and mechanical codes typically adopt or modify the International Residential Code; follow these local rules and obtain permits with inspections.

Installation tips and regular maintenance

A licensed plumber or HVAC technician should handle gas-line connections to satisfy pressure and safety standards. Maintain specified clearances and install the correct venting components per the manufacturer. In regions with hard water, a whole-house softener or inline filter helps reduce scale on the heat exchanger.

Annual inspections should include checking burner performance, testing for gas leaks, and verifying vent integrity. Descale the heat exchanger whenever mineral buildup lowers flow rates or temperature rise. Consistent maintenance keeps non-electric and no-electricity water heaters efficient and extends their service life.

Topic Recommendation Why it matters
Gas-line hookup Hire a licensed professional Helps guarantee proper pressure, leak-free joints, and code compliance
Venting type Follow manufacturer instructions and local code for direct, power, or atmospheric venting Prevents backdraft, CO buildup, and maintains efficiency
Water quality treatment Install filter or softener in hard water areas Reduces scale on heat exchangers and preserves flow rates
Regular service Schedule yearly inspections and descale when required Helps maintain performance and avoids early failures
Safety protections Install CO detectors and provide proper combustion air Protects occupants and meets code requirements

Solar water heaters as alternative water heating options

Solar thermal is a practical way to reduce fuel costs and lower carbon emissions. Rooftop collectors can be connected to existing tanks or used within dedicated off-grid systems. Here you’ll find comparisons of system types, cold-climate protections, and guidance on combining solar with non-electric backups.

Active vs passive system overview

Active systems employ a pump and controller to circulate heat-transfer fluid between collectors and storage. They offer precise control, higher efficiency in varied sun conditions, and easier integration with large tanks. You can expect more components and a modest electrical draw for the pump and controller.

Passive systems instead use natural convection forces. Designs like integral collector-storage and thermosiphon move warm water up into a tank without electricity. These systems often have long lifespans and require minimal maintenance. They perform well when roof and tank positions are favorable for gravity-driven circulation.

Designs that manage freezing and cold conditions

For cold climates, freeze protection is absolutely essential. Drainback systems drain collectors when the pump shuts off, which helps prevent freeze damage. Closed-loop systems use propylene glycol antifreeze and a heat exchanger to safeguard potable water. Freeze-tolerant collectors offer additional resilience during harsh winter conditions.

Choose frost-resistant collectors and components sized correctly for your climate. Routinely check valves, pumps, and glycol concentration to maintain performance and avoid mid-winter failures.

Combining solar with non-electric backup systems

Combining solar thermal panels with a tankless propane or wood-fired heater gives you backup capacity. Solar handles daily loads and preheats water when sunlight is available. On cloudy days or during high-demand peaks, the non-electric unit supplies the shortfall without grid power reliance.

Such a hybrid strategy is well suited to off-grid water heating and supports energy-efficient operation by cutting annual fuel use. Design your control scheme so the backup heater activates only when stored water falls under the target temperature.

Choosing the right no-electric unit for your needs

Selecting the right system for off-grid living water heaters means carefully examining your hot water usage. Small choices now can influence comfort, cost, and installation complexity later. Use the checklist and table below to find a unit that matches your household’s needs, space, and fuel options.

Assessing hot water demand and peak flow rates

Estimate gallons per minute (GPM) for each fixture that may run at the same time. A typical shower needs about 1.5–2.5 GPM, a kitchen sink around 1–1.5 GPM, and a dishwasher about 1–1.5 GPM. Add the flows for simultaneous uses to find your peak GPM.

Measure your incoming groundwater temperature. The colder the inlet water, the more output you’ll need to reach a comfortable shower temperature. Use your desired output temperature and inlet temperature to size both tankless and tank systems correctly.

Checklist for space, venting, and fuel availability

Check available indoor and outdoor installation space and clearances. Ensure you have suitable vent termination paths for combustion units and can meet clearance rules from brands like Rinnai or Bosch.

Check your on-site fuels, whether that means propane tanks, natural gas lines, or a wood supply. If you’re considering combined systems, evaluate whether your roof orientation and tilt are suitable for solar collectors. Make sure there is safe access for future servicing and routine maintenance tasks.

Budget ranges and long-term cost comparison

Look at both upfront price and lifecycle cost for the main no electricity water heater types. Tankless propane heaters are generally cheaper to buy and install than full solar collector systems. Solar collectors plus storage tanks require a higher initial investment but offer lower ongoing fuel costs.

Include maintenance, fuel, and expected lifespan when doing your calculations. No-electric tank designs with self-cleaning features can reduce descaling and service visits, improving long-term value for remote sites.

System Type Typical Upfront Cost (USD) Estimated lifetime (years) Fuel and maintenance notes
Tankless propane unit \$800–\$2,500 10 – 15 Requires a propane supply; periodic burner cleaning; works well for high GPM when correctly sized.
Passive solar collectors + tank \$2,000–\$8,000 15 – 25 Minimal fuel costs; freeze protection needed in cold climates; roof space and orientation important.
Wood-fired heater (indirect) \$1,200 – \$5,000 15–30 Requires steady wood supply; simple mechanics; more frequent inspection and ash removal.
Self-cleaning no-electric tank designs \$900–\$3,500 12 – 20 Reduced descaling requirements; ideal for limited service access; pairs effectively with solar or wood backups.

When choosing no-electric unit options, balance peak flow needs, available fuel, and site constraints. Focus on systems that meet your day-to-day needs and long-term budget for reliable hot water in off-grid living water heater arrangements.

Safety, codes, and maintenance for non-electric heaters

Choosing a non-electric water heater requires you to prioritize safety and maintenance as much as performance. Consistent maintenance preserves efficiency and lowers overall risk. Knowing local regulations and following basic safety guidelines helps protect your home and family.

Put a seasonal maintenance checklist in place. Inspect vents and flues for corrosion or blockages. Periodically flush tanks and heat exchangers to remove built-up sediment. Test pressure-relief valves annually to confirm they work correctly. Keep an eye out for scale and descale as needed. Confirm that self-cleaning features operate properly to control bacterial and dirt accumulation.

Ensure combustion-based systems are safe with simple precautions. Install carbon monoxide detectors near sleeping areas and next to the heater. Maintain open ventilation paths and combustion air supplies. Have a qualified technician inspect burners and heat exchangers annually. Store propane cylinders upright and away from living spaces, and keep firewood off the structure and away from vents.

You must comply with local water heater codes. Verify venting rules, combustion air requirements, clearance distances, and any seismic strapping rules. Many jurisdictions require permits for gas or wood installations and demand final inspections. Contact your local building department before starting any work and hire licensed contractors for gas or other combustion-related installations.

To maintain no electricity water heaters effectively, set up a consistent service plan. Do a visual check each month and book professional servicing every year. Track inspection dates, repairs, and part replacements in a log. Good maintenance extends system life and catches problems before they cause expensive failures.

Adhere to manufacturer guidelines and national standards from agencies like the National Fuel Gas Code (NFPA 54) and local amendments. Observing water heater codes and non-electric heater safety practices cuts hazards, keeps you compliant, and supports long-term reliability.

Comparing upfront costs and long-term savings of alternative water heating options

When deciding between propane tankless, solar thermal, and wood-fired or indirect systems, it’s essential to consider both upfront costs and long-term savings. Each option has unique purchase prices, installation complexities, and maintenance requirements. Factors like roof-mounted collectors, venting runs, and gas-line work significantly influence the final costs.

Initial purchase and installation cost breakdown

Tankless propane units typically range from \$700 to \$2,500. Installation, including gas-line upgrades and venting, can add around \$500 to \$2,000. Solar thermal solutions can cost \$4,000–\$12,000 for collectors, tanks, and controls, not including additional roof and piping work. Wood-fired or indirect systems with a boiler and storage tank typically run \$2,500–\$8,000, depending on materials and installation difficulty.

Operating costs, fuel expenses, and expected lifespan

Propane costs vary by region and involves steady annual fuel bills and periodic maintenance. Wood-fired systems require handling fuel and maintaining a seasonal supply, which can be economical where wood is inexpensive. Solar thermal systems have negligible ongoing fuel costs once installed, but you should budget for pump and control repairs. System lifespans can be roughly 10–20 years for tankless propane, 15–30 years for solar collectors/tanks, and 15–25 years for durable wood-fired or indirect designs. Tanks with self-cleaning features often trim maintenance needs and overall lifetime expenses.

Available incentives, rebates, and tax credits for eco-friendly systems

Federal, state, and local incentives can significantly reduce the net cost of energy-efficient and solar thermal systems. It’s important to check the Database of State Incentives for Renewables & Efficiency and contact your local utility about rebates and tax credit opportunities. Because incentives frequently change, always confirm the latest programs before committing to a system.

System type Typical equipment cost Typical installation cost Annual Fuel/Operating Cost Expected Lifespan
Tankless propane \$700–\$2,500 \$500–\$2,000 including venting and gas-line work Moderate; depends on local propane prices 10–20 years
Solar Thermal \$4,000–\$12,000 (collectors, tank, controls) \$1,000–\$4,000 for roof work and piping Minimal fuel cost; maintenance for pumps/controls 15 – 30 years
Wood-fired / Indirect \$2,500–\$8,000 (boiler, tank) \$800–\$3,000 (chimney, piping, labor) Low to moderate; depends on wood cost and labor input 15 – 25 years

Materials, Care & Installation for Large Wall Art

Selecting the right materials and a smart care routine ensures big canvas art remains vibrant for years. This guide covers common materials, safe hanging methods, and basic maintenance for oversized wall decor. It offers practical advice for both home and studio settings.

Common materials and their benefits.

Stretched cotton and linen canvases are popular for modern abstracts thanks to their warm texture and deep color. Gallery-wrapped edges eliminate the need for frames, presenting a sleek, modern aesthetic. Prints, on the other hand, employ archival pigment inks on canvas to resist fading and maintain color accuracy over time.

Hanging methods for safety & balance.

  • French cleats offer secure, level support for large wall art and big canvas art. They evenly distribute weight and make repositioning easier.
  • Heavy-duty picture hangers or toggle anchors are suitable for drywall when studs are inaccessible. Make sure the hardware can support the artwork’s weight.
  • Place the artwork’s visual centre about 57–60 inches from the floor. Adjust when placing above furniture to maintain visual balance.

Care & preservation tips.

Dust canvases with a soft brush or a dry microfiber cloth. Avoid direct spraying of cleaners. Avoid placing large wall art in direct sunlight to reduce fading. Maintain stable humidity levels to prevent warping or mold.

When you may need professional help.

For original paintings with flaking paint, stains, or structural issues, consult a professional conservator. Restoration professionals use high-grade materials and proven methods to preserve value and integrity.

Fast checklist for installation and upkeep.

  1. Ensure the artwork weight matches or exceeds the chosen hardware rating.
  2. Use studs or appropriate anchors for secure mounting.
  3. Measure so the artwork’s center sits at eye level, adjusting for furniture height.
  4. Dust regularly and keep away from direct sunlight or damp spaces.

Adhering to these guidelines ensures that large wall art and big canvas art remain in optimal condition. Proper materials care and installation extend the life of oversized wall decor, preserving the artist’s vision.
